Well it's a red-letter week for web software, the public beta of Lilly has finally been released which means all of us who drooled over it can now finally play with it. If that was not enough, the long awaited (2.5 years) release of Joomla 1.5 has finally been made it out of beta and into what they are calling "Joomla! 1.5 Stable [Khepri]".

[PAM] goofed around with a version of Bill Orcutt's mysql object for Max/MSP Jitter. Which was amazing but was abandoned by Bill to peruse Lilly. We forgave him as loadbang.net released a JAVA based mysql object that was just as good.
Think of Lilly as MAX/MSP/Jitter for Websites in terms of it's ability to build applications in a graphic environment. It's pretty cool. There isn't 1 to 1 translation of MAX/MSP Jitter
objects to or from Lilly but we think you'll see the immediate similarities and possibilities for good old fashion creative fun.
As for Joomla 1.5, there are some amazing features and it represents a quantum leap forward in it's architecture and code base. Think cool ALAX stuff, SEO out of the box, clean URLS and strong meta data tools, LDAP, and numerous other changes that will be an added welcome.
[PAM] has been using Joomla 1.10 with many hacks and tweaks under the hood and has held off upgrading because it has been so stable. Believe it or not, in the 2 years [PAM] that has been online we've only been dark for all of about 5 minutes and that was due to an outage at our data center. If it isn't broke don't fix it, but now that a new version of Joomla is out we can expect to see some much needed improvements to the web site.
